The Student Room Group

Personal Statement for Drama schools?

I'm applying for three Drama schools through UCAS itself, but three others are through its individual applications and one of them is through UCAS Conservatoires.
I was just wondering if I had to do loads of personal statements for each individual place of application (one for UCAS, one for UCAS Con one for LAMDA etc..)

I reckon copying and pasting them would be wrong, wouldn't it? Eventhough it's my individual words I'm still copying?

If LAMDA are the only one reading the PS you send to LAMDA, you can personalise that one to LAMDA, why you want to study there specifically etc. Same with the one institution you apply to through UCAS Con.:smile:

Check that UCAS can't do you for plagiarism for similarity between applications through the main application system and the Conservatoire application. I'm not sure whether this might happen or not.:unsure:

You can’t be done for plagiarism if it’s your own work. It’s fine to use your own personal statement more than once for different applications. I had several versions of mine for different drama schools as they each had different requirements, but with large sections exactly the same and I had a UCAS one too. It was absolutely fine to do that.
